WebThe process of reflection is a cycle which needs to be repeated. • Teach. • Self-assess the effect your teaching has had on learning. • Consider new ways of teaching which can improve the quality of learning. • Try these ideas in practice. • Repeat the process. WebA key part of continuing professional development (CPD) as recommended by The British Psychological Society (BPS) is adopting a reflective based practices approach to … WebJul 1, 2024 · Reflective practice is a strategy promoted as a way to improve professional performance and to develop expertise. Intentional reflection on work situations can lead to improved understanding of a specific situation, identify strategies for similar situations in the future, and uncover assumptions that hinder service to patrons.

WebVigilant critical reflection delivers several boons: inspirational self-assuredness, the regular achievement of teaching goals, and motivated, critically reflective students. The goal of the critically reflective teacher, for Brookfield, is to garner an increased awareness of his or her teaching from as many different vantage points as possible.
